Snappin' Necks is the debut studio album by the American rap metal band Stuck Mojo, released in 1995.{{cite book |last1=Sharpe-Young |first1=Garry |title=Metal: The Definitive Guide: Heavy, NWOBH, Progressive, Thrash, Death, Black, Gothic, Doom, Nu |date=2007 |publisher=Jawbone Press |page=460}}{{cite news |title=Stuck with It |work=Daily Press |agency=Chicago Tribune |date=26 Jan 1996 |location=Newport News |department=InRoads |page=12}} The album was preceded by three separate demos, one of which landed the band a recording contract with Century Media Records in 1994, which led to this album. A video for "Not Promised Tomorrow" was also produced by Drew Stone of Stone Films.
